Obby: Three Challenges
About Obby: Three Challenges
Three separate obstacle courses are stitched into Obby: Three Challenges, and each one leans on a different hazard so the skills from the first section don't carry over cleanly to the next. One challenge is built around timing, with platforms that only exist for a beat before vanishing, while another cares more about precision jumps across gaps too wide for a single press of space. The double jump is available throughout, but knowing when to save it versus spend it early changes course to course, since some sections punish an early jump with nothing left to correct a bad landing. Holding the right mouse button to steady the camera helps more on the timing sections than the jumping ones. Checkpoints save progress within a challenge, not across all three.
How to Play
- Complete each of the three obstacle courses in turn
- Use Space for a jump and a second tap for a double jump
- Save the double jump for gaps a single jump can't clear
- Reach each course's finish line to unlock the next challenge

Why does the double jump feel unreliable in the second challenge?
The second challenge sizes its gaps so a single jump falls just short, meaning the double jump is a requirement there rather than a bonus. Tapping jump too early on the first press makes the second jump fire while you are still rising, which loses the extra distance you needed.
